YAML语法

YAML语法格式

key: value 表示一对键值对(冒号后面必须要有空格)

使用空格缩进表示层级关系

左侧缩进的空格数目不重要,只要同一层级的元素左侧对齐即可

key 与 value 大小写敏感

YMAL常用写法

字面量: 数值,字符串,布尔,日期

字符串 默认不用加上引号;

“” 使用 双引号 不会转义特殊字符,特殊字符最终会转成本来想表示含义输出

name: "mengxuegu jiaoyu" 输出: mengxuegu 换行 jiaoyu

'' 使用 单引号 会转义特殊字符,特殊字符当作一个普通的字符串输出

name: 'mengxuegu jiaoyu 输出: mengxuegu jiaoyu

对象 & Map

key: value value存储对象,每个值换一行写,注意值要左对齐

ermp
lastNmae: xiaoming
age: 22
money: 10000

数组(List、Set)

用 - 值表示数组中的一个元素

fortes
- java
- js
- python

 

原文地址:https://www.cnblogs.com/guangzhou11/p/12381799.html